According to 6Wresearch internal database and industry insights, the Global Solar Hydrogen Panel Market was valued at USD 0.75 Billion in 2024 and is expected to reach USD 1.09 Billion by 2031, growing at a compound annual growth rate of 5.60% during the forecast period (2025-2031).
The Global Solar Hydrogen Panel Market is experiencing significant growth driven by the increasing emphasis on renewable energy sources and the transition towards cleaner energy production. Solar hydrogen panels, which utilize solar energy to produce hydrogen through water electrolysis, offer a sustainable and efficient way to store and utilize renewable energy. The market is being fueled by growing investments in research and development, advancements in technology, and government initiatives promoting the adoption of hydrogen as a clean fuel source. Key players are focusing on innovation to improve the efficiency and cost-effectiveness of solar hydrogen panels, further driving market expansion. The market is expected to witness continued growth as countries worldwide strive to achieve carbon neutrality and reduce greenhouse gas emissions.

One significant challenge faced in the Global Solar Hydrogen Panel Market is the high initial investment cost associated with the technology. The production and installation of solar hydrogen panels require advanced materials and technology, leading to a relatively high upfront cost for consumers and businesses. Additionally, the efficiency of current solar hydrogen panels is still being improved, impacting the overall competitiveness of the market. Another challenge is the lack of widespread infrastructure for hydrogen storage and distribution, which hinders the adoption of solar hydrogen panels on a larger scale. Overcoming these challenges will be crucial for the market to realize its full potential and achieve widespread acceptance as a clean energy solution.

Government policies related to the Global Solar Hydrogen Panel Market vary by country, with many governments offering incentives and subsidies to promote the adoption of renewable energy sources like solar hydrogen panels. In the United States, the Investment Tax Credit (ITC) provides a 30% tax credit for residential and commercial solar installations, including solar hydrogen panels. In the European Union, the Renewable Energy Directive sets binding targets for renewable energy use, encouraging the deployment of solar hydrogen technologies. Additionally, countries like Japan and South Korea have implemented feed-in tariffs to incentivize the production of solar hydrogen energy. Overall, government policies play a crucial role in driving the growth of the Global Solar Hydrogen Panel Market by providing financial support and regulatory frameworks to encourage investment and innovation in this emerging sector.
